this is something that doesn't just start and end w/ hockey canada btw.
it's a tumblr blogger selling "crosbussy" merchandise to fans, and encouraging them to wear it to games. it is that very same tumblr blogger getting asked by a team to create their pride night merch. it is a tiktokker pointedly yelling "krak my back" next to home bench during warmups and making so many overt sexual comments both on and offline that a player's wife needs to speak up about it. it is seattle's media team intertwining itself so closely with the sexually explicit side of booktok that the franchise's reputation is permanently tainted.
it's a juniors coach assaulting the kids on his team and getting paid out by his organization. it is hockey canada and usa hockey continuing to push the envelope with what is excusable in their organizations. it is chronic drug and alcohol abuse being excusable until one of your players physically assaults his teammates.
it's a juniors player jumping out of a building and killing himself after failure to perform. it's a fifth overall pick refusing to show up to the team that drafted him because he's uncomfortable around the franchise staff, and becoming the joke of the league. it is said draft pick explicitly stating "i do not feel safe around [these] specific men" and the entire league calling him an entitled pussy anyway.*
it's a coach demanding to see the phones and private photos of the men he holds power over, threatening them with trades or waivers if they don't, and fans calling the men that speak up weak and soft.
this didn't come out of nowhere. you can't beat hockey culture out of hockey players from the top down. this starts with you, this starts with your kids, and this starts with what you say online. holding the nhl and hockey canada accountable doesn't mean shit when you yourself are part of the fucking problem.
